As an academic award

In some countries, such as Australia, a diploma is a specific academic award of lower rank that a academic degree. In Ireland a National Diploma is below the standard of the honours bachelor degree, whilst the Higher Diploma is taken after the bachelor degree. In Germany and Austria the diploma is the standard academic degree, comparable with the Master's degree.
